Christopher Tanev is an ice hockey defenseman for the Toronto Maple Leafs as of 2025. He attended the Rochester Institute of Technology, where he studied finance while playing college hockey. Tanev's junior and college career began in the Ontario Provincial Junior Hockey League with the Durham Fury in 2006-07.

After spending time with other teams in the league, Tanev played with the Markham Royals in the 2008–09 season, leading all defensemen with 41 points. He then moved on to NCAA Division I with the Rochester Institute of Technology Tigers in 2009–10, where he earned Atlantic Hockey Rookie of the Year honors and was named to the All-Rookie and Third All-Star Teams. Tanev won the Atlantic Hockey Conference championship with RIT and was named to the All-Tournament Team.

Chris Tanev Teams

Chris Tanev has played for the Vancouver Canucks, Calgary Flames, Dallas Stars, and Toronto Maple Leafs, as per the official website of the NHL.

Vancouver Canucks

Chris Tanev signed with the Vancouver Canucks as an undrafted free agent on May 31, 2010. He spent his rookie season with the Canucks' AHL affiliate, the Manitoba Moose, before being called up to the NHL in January 2011. Tanev appeared in the Stanley Cup Final in 2011. Tanev remained with the Canucks for 10 seasons and even scored a memorable overtime goal in the 2020 playoffs against the Minnesota Wild. In 2015, he signed a five-year contract extension.

Calgary Flames

In October 2020, Chris Tanev left the Vancouver Canucks after 10 seasons and signed a four-year, $18 million contract with the Calgary Flames.

Dallas Stars

On February 28, 2024, Chris Tanev was traded from the Calgary Flames to the Dallas Stars in a three-team deal involving the New Jersey Devils. The trade also involved some salary retention by the Devils and additional draft picks, as per Spotrac.

Toronto Maple Leafs

On July 1, 2024, Tanev signed a six-year, $27 million contract with the Toronto Maple Leafs, following his trade to the team from the Dallas Stars, as per Spotrac.
